111 Whitebeam Road

    111, WHITEBEAM ROAD, BIRMINGHAM, BIRMINGHAM, B37 7PE

    This semi-detached leasehold property on Whitebeam Road last sold in May 2002 for £79,950. Based on price growth in the B37 district since then, its estimated current value is £221,542 — placing it in the 30th percentile nationally and the 58th percentile within B37. The property covers 80 m² (861 sq ft), giving an estimated value of £2,769 per m². The EPC rating is D, with a potential rating of B.
